 I have been taking pictures of some of the meals I have had over the week and I decided I would share them with you. These are pictures of some of my lunches and as you can see they are mainly salad based. When I eat bread I eat whole bread that is super seeded. I just love the taste of it. I love salads now. I used to hate them and if I had some I would only stick to lettuce, the iceberg type because it tasted quite sweet to me. However I have taught myself to eat other types like rocket, spinach, watercress and I love them all. I can add different things in my salads like avocado, olives, carrots etc.  I have discovered that salads do not have to be boring, just adding different things makes all the difference. My salad dressing is usually olive oil and I put a mixture of garlic and parsley herbs or some black pepper granules, or lemon if I want that zest taste. Fruit is also an essential part to my diet. If I ate my lunch for instance and I did not feel full, I have a fruit to supplement that or if I need to snack.
